Leighton Meester Reveals the Secret to “Normal” Marriage with Adam Brody
View
Date:2025-04-11 16:35:15
You know you love Leighton Meester and Adam Brody's relationship—and there's no need to gossip about the secret to their nine-year marriage.
Allow the Gossip Girl alum to tell you herself.
Admitting the pair have a "normal relationship with all the good and the hard," Leighton exclusively told E! News' Courtney Lopez for the Nov. 21 episode, "We just make it work."
"We're super, super lucky, and I think we recognize how lucky we are with one another," she continued. "We give each other a lot of respect and time and attention and focus. Like, really put our time and energy into a relationship."
And Leighton—who shares 8-year-old daughter Arlo and a 3-year-old son with the O.C. alum—added that, of course, it helps when you genuinely enjoy each other's company. (Catch more of her interview on E! News Nov. 21 at 11 p.m.)
But while she has a low-key romance with Adam, the same can't exactly be said for the characters she plays onscreen. Take her new movie EXmas, in which her character Ali secretly attends her ex Graham's (Robbie Amell) family Christmas because she simply missed his parents.
"This is the heightened reality of wish fulfillment of like, 'My ex, but we do get along, but it just didn't work out, but they love my family and family loves them,'" Leighton shared with E!. "No—real life, you're like, 'That's a stalker. That's not good.'"
Understandably, Leighton would not want to have her former flame decking the halls with her fam IRL.
"I don't even want to like think about that," she quipped. "That would be terrible."
And would Adam even allow it?
"I wouldn't allow it," she joked. "All his exes, I'm like, they seem like pretty good people. And my family, he can have ‘em. I don't think that that would be the case."
EXmas is now streaming on Amazon Freevee.
For a look back at Leighton and Adam's merry and bright romance, scroll on.
Leighton Meester and Adam Brody flaunted some sweet PDA while heading to a Mexican restaurant in 2013.
As romance rumors continued to swirl, the pair declined to publicly comment on the status of their relationship. But you know what they say, a picture's worth a thousand words.
After keeping under the radar for months, the twosome resurfaced in New York City together.
They may have never confirmed their relationship, but Brody put a diamond on his lady's finger. Nearly a month after the engagement news broke, the pair were photographed stealing a smooch in South Africa.
The notoriously private couple got married in a super-secretive ceremony in 2014.
Meester supported her handsome beau at the premiere of his movie Shazam in 2019. No doubt their daughter, Arlo, loves that her dad is a superhero!
Brody previously shared that becoming a father with Meester is "the best in every way."
In their spare time, this couple enjoys giving back to their community, although they aren't ones to actively publicize their good deeds.
After working on 2011's The Oranges, the two once again reunited on the set of Meester's show Single Parents in 2019. In his guest role, Brody played Meester's ex.
While the couple never announced they were expecting baby No. 2, Brody confirmed in September 2020 that his wife gave birth to their second child.
